A Pet for Lawrence

1/11/2020

5 Comments

 
I figured Lawrence could use some kind of animal companion, and since I already had a big black wolf figure, I thought that would be perfect. It was gift from Jan some years back, and I had always intended to paint it up some and use it for scenes with Little Red Riding Hood. 

So I printed out some pictures of 'black' timber wolves as a reference....

I spent all afternoon one day this past week, trying to paint him up. Then as luck would have it, one of the outfits that I still needed to photograph for old missing Gallery photos, was the BID size 'Mini Jennet', which just happens to come with a red bonnet. So I dressed Nami in it, and took her outside with the wolf for some photos....
